A Genuine, Simple Diagnostic Test Worth Trying First — Skoda Superb Front Bumper

If one or more parking sensors seem unresponsive, a genuinely useful, well-corroborated DIY check before paying for diagnostics: with the ignition on and reverse selected, place your ear close to each sensor in turn — a healthy sensor produces an audible clicking or ticking sound as it pulses. A sensor that stays silent while the others click is a strong indication that specific sensor (or its wiring) has failed, letting you narrow down the problem before a garage visit.

Worth knowing: oversensitive parking sensors triggering on genuinely distant objects — street signs, raised kerbs, even during heavy rain — are a real, recurring complaint across several Skoda models, and the sensitivity of the audible warning (though not always the underlying detection distance) can often be adjusted through the infotainment settings if the constant beeping is more annoying than useful. Skoda Superb Front Bumper: More Than Just a Plastic Panel

The Skoda Superb's front bumper typically carries more than styling — parking sensors, adaptive cruise radar, and fog light housings are all commonly built in, so even a minor impact can mean more than a simple panel swap.

Before you buy: bumper specification varies significantly by trim, particularly around parking sensor cutouts, radar mounting points and fog light provisions. Always confirm against your VIN before ordering.

Skoda Superb Front Bumper: What It Does

Beyond absorbing minor impacts, the front bumper on higher trims of the Superb often houses parking sensors, the radar sensor used for adaptive cruise control, and fog lights. A bumper that looks compatible can still be missing the correct cutouts or mounting provisions for your specific trim's equipment.
